In Corsica, the granite subsoil considerably complicates pipeline work. Digging a trench often involves a hydraulic rock breaker, vibrations that threaten stone walls, noise loud enough to wake the maquis shrubland, and a skyrocketing bill. Not to mention the steep terrain, narrow village access points, and perched houses where no excavator can reach.
Pipe relining bypasses all these obstacles. Jean-Marie accesses your pipes through existing inspection chambers and deploys a resin liner inside the damaged pipe. The resin hardens in a few hours, forming a new, watertight conduit inside the old one. No granite to break, no land to restore.
Granite. Digging a trench in Corsican soil requires heavy equipment (rock breaker, reinforced mini-excavator) and takes much longer than in softer soil. Pipe lining eliminates this step entirely: work is done inside the pipe, and the soil type is irrelevant.
